| * xcb: Use a placeholder QScreen when there are no outputs connectedBłażej Szczygieł2015-12-111-121/+152
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| If no screens are available, windows could disappear, could stop rendering graphics, or the application could crash. This is a real use case in several scenarios: with x11vnc, when all monitors are physically disconnected from a desktop machine, or in some cases even when the monitor sleeps. Now when the last screen is disconnected, it is transformed into a fake screen. When a physical screen appears, the fake QScreen is transformed into a representation of the physical screen. Every virtual desktop has its own fake screen, and primary screens must belong to the primary virtual desktop. It fixes updating screen geometry on temporarily disabled screens in the middle of the mode switch. Expected results: Windows don't disappear, the application doesn't crash, and QMenu is displayed on the appropriate screen. * xcb: Compress mouse motion and touch update eventsGatis Paeglis2015-09-221-73/+147
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The current version of the mouse motion event compression algorithm does not work with certain configurations - situations where we get one XCB_GE_GENERIC event between every XCB_MOTION_NOTIFY event. The new implementation tries to be less fragile. The previous approach checked "is *the next* event the same type as the current event", the new check asks "have we buffered more events of the same type as the current event". We buffer events of the same type only when the main thread is unresponsive. This patch adds event compression for XI_TouchUpdate in addition to the fix for motion even compression. | * When a screen comes back online, the windows need to be told about itRalf Jung2015-07-221-0/+8
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| On my system, this fixes the misbehavior of Qt applications when the (only) active screen is switched, e.g. from an external screen to the laptop. This behavior is caused by the screen() of widgets to be set to NULL when their screen goes away. When a new screen comes online, the widgets *should* be told about it, but they are not. The only place that "maybeSetScreen" is called is when an existing screen changes its geometry, but not when a screen gets enabled without its geometry being affected in any way (e.g. because it was just disabled via xrandr, but has been connected all along). This makes sure that "maybeSetScreen" is also called when a screen gets enabled. | * xcb: Use XIGrabDevice instead of xcb_grab_pointer with XI 2.2Laszlo Agocs2015-06-011-44/+35
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Switch to using the pointer events from XI2 when touch is available (i.e. version is >= 2.2). This allows us to select and grab the button and motion events together with the touch ones. This prevents the issue of not getting touch events when grabbing via the plain xcb functions. To prevent touch sequences from being replayed after ungrabbing (for example after dismissing a popup that caused a grab), we try to accept touches via XIAllowTouchEvents. Unfortunately this leads to a deadlock and therefore we can only do it when we know we have a new enough libXi. This is a configure time check which is not ideal since the system on which apps run can have a newer libXi than the machine that did the Qt build, but seems like the best we can do. The environment variable QT_XCB_NO_XI2_MOUSE can be set to 1 in order to prevent processing mouse events through XInput. This restores the old behavior with broken grabbing. [ChangeLog][QtGui] Pointer event delivery on X11 is now done via XInput 2.2+ when available. | * Improve handling of XRandR events in XCB backendDaniel Vrátil2015-03-111-80/+213
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Querying X server for data can be very expensive, especially when there are multiple processes querying it at the same time (which is exactly what happens when screen configuration changes and all Qt applications receive XRandR change notifications). This patch is aiming to reduce the number of queries to X server as much as possible by making use of detailed information available in the RRCrtcChangeNotify and RROutputChangeNotify events. Firstly, the backend now does not rebuild all QXcbScreens on any change (which involved the very expensive xcb_randr_get_screen_resources() call), but only builds the full set of QXcbScreens once in initializeScreens(), and then just incrementally updates it. Secondly, it avoids querying X server for all screens geometry as much as possible, and only does so when CRTC/Output change notification for a particular screen is delivered. As a result, handling of all XRandR events on screen change is reduced from tens of seconds to less then a seconds and applications are better responsive after that, because we don't block the event loop for long. The X server is also more responsive after the screen change, since we are not overloading it with requests. | * Decide whether to synthesize mouse events on a per device basisAlexander Volkov2015-02-251-1/+0
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Currently Qt uses the QPlatformIntegration::StyleHint SynthesizeMouseFromTouchEvents to check whether to synthesize mouse events from touch events. But not only platform plugins can produce touch events, they can be created by e.g. QTest::touchEvent() and in this case we almost definitely need synthesizing regardless of the platform. This commit introduces a QTouchDevice::MouseEmulation capability which replaces use of the QPlatformIntegration::SynthesizeMouseFromTouchEvents. So it's possible to pass QTouchDevice without this capability to QTest::touchEvent() and be sure that mouse events will be synthesized. Notice that touch pads always emulate mouse events. As a result we can activate some tests which were disabled for specific platform configurations by commits 6c1670d8c273819435867c42725c0db0eee597dc and e9760f1559361c39f269fb89f1ebd01f6ee8378d.
